Interview realized by Dr. Liviu OLTEANU with H.E. Dr. Ahmed SHAHEED, the Unites Nations Special Rapporteur on Freedom of Religion or Belief (FoRB)



Brussels, Jun 2018

His Excellency Dr. Ahmed Shaheed – with a strong expertise on diplomacy, human rights and religious freedom – is the current Special Rapporteur on Freedom of Religion or Belief of the United Nations. He offered recently to Dr. Liviu Olteanu, the Secretary General of the AIDLR a consistent, important and exclusive interview, where underlines and advises on many contemporary issues. The interview was published recently in the book « Diplomacy and Education for Freedom of Religion, A Priority for Public Policy » (2018), and it looks to the greatest challenges for freedom of religion on the 21st Century.
